A Full Range of Optical Correction is Available

Richmond Eye Associates affiliated Optical Shops provide an excellent selection of frame and lens choices with expert fitting and adjustment by certified opticians.

Dr. Donald Lumpkin offers contact lens fitting at the Innsbrook and Mechanicsville offices. Dr. Katherine Schlieper offers contact lens fitting at the Innsbrook and Midlothian (Koger South) offices.

Contact lens options include astigmatism correcting lenses, tinted lenses, bifocal lenses, disposables, and more. Laser Vision Correction (LASIK and PRK) is available, which can help to surgically reduce the need for glasses and contact lenses.

Careful choice of intraocular lens implants at the time of cataract extraction can help to reduce the need for a glasses prescription after cataract surgery, including Advanced Technology Lens Implants that correct nearsightedness, farsightedness, astigmatism, and even the need for reading glasses.
